Iolite is the deep blue gem variety of the silicate mineral cordierite, named for French geologist Pierre Cordier. Iolite is found on Garnet Island in Canada and in South Asia and South Africa. Leif Eriksson and other Viking explorers are said to have used thin slices of iolite to navigate during voyages, taking advantage of its prismatic properties to polarize sunlight.

Kyanite takes its name from from the Greek word kyanos which means "deep blue." Formerly called disthene, kyanite is found primarily in shades of blues and greens. The shiny, translucent gemstone is known for its color zones and variation in hardness. Zodiac signs associated with kyanite are Aries, Taurus and Libra. The stone is said to have an effect on dreams and in improving memory and encouraging mental clarity.

Beautiful mother-of-pearl has long been used in jewelry and for other decorative purposes. Also known as nacre, mother-of-pearl is the lustrous layer found on the inside of shells of certain mollusk species. The smoothness of the material protects the mollusk's body and defends against damage and disease. If the mollusk's body becomes irritated by a parasite or foreign body, the animal may isolate the cause of the problem by encasing it in secreted nacre. The resulting object is a pearl.
